Du kan føje en brugerdefineret kolonne til den aktuelle forespørgsel ved at oprette en formel. Power Query validerer formelsyntaksen på samme måde som dialogboksen Redigering af forespørgsel. Du kan finde flere oplysninger om Power Query formelsprog under Opret Power Query formler.
-
Hvis du vil åbne en forespørgsel, skal du finde en, der tidligere er indlæst fra Power Query-editor, markere en celle i dataene og derefter vælge Forespørgsel > Rediger. Få mere at vide under Opret, rediger og indlæs en forespørgsel i Excel.
-
Vælg Tilføj kolonne > Brugerdefineret kolonne. dialogboksen Brugerdefineret kolonne vises.
-
Angiv et nyt kolonnenavn.
-
Indsæt en kolonne i feltet Brugerdefineret kolonneformel ved at vælge en kolonne på listen Tilgængelige kolonner , og vælg derefter Indsæt.= each [Total] + [SalesTax].
Bemærk Du kan referere til flere kolonner, så længe du adskiller dem med en operator. Hvis du f.eks. vil beregne en TotalSales-kolonne, kan du lægge Total og SalesTax sammen ved hjælp af formlen -
Vælg OK.
-
Når du har tilføjet en brugerdefineret kolonne, skal du kontrollere, at den har en passende datatype. Hvis du ser ikonet Alle til venstre for kolonneoverskriften, skal du ændre datatypen til det ønskede. Du kan få mere at vide under Tilføj eller rediger datatyper.
Tip Du kan prøve en anden tilgang for at få de ønskede resultater. Brug en brugerdefineret kolonne til at flette værdier fra to eller flere kolonner til en enkelt brugerdefineret kolonne. Du kan få mere at vide under Flette kolonner.
Følgende tabel opsummerer almindelige eksempler på brugerdefinerede formler.
Formel |
Beskrivelse |
---|---|
"abc" |
Opretter en kolonne, som indeholder teksten abc i alle rækker. |
1+1 |
Opretter en kolonne, som indeholder resultatet af 1 + 1 (2) i alle rækker. |
[UnitPrice] * [Quantity] |
Opretter en kolonne, som indeholder resultatet af multipliceringen af to tabelkolonner. |
[UnitPrice] * (1 – [Discount]) * [Quantity] |
Beregner den samlede pris med hensyn til kolonnen Rabat. |
"Hello" & [Name] |
Kombinerer Kære med indholdet af kolonnen Navn i en ny kolonne. |
Date.DayOfWeekName([DOB]) |
Opretter en ny kolonne, der viser et ugedagsnavn, f.eks. Mandag, der er afledt af en DOB Dato/klokkeslæt-kolonnedatatype. |
DateTime.Time([DOB]) |
Opretter en ny kolonne, der kun viser det klokkeslæt, der er afledt af en DOB Dato/klokkeslæt-kolonnedatatype. |
Date.Month([DOB]) |
Opretter en ny kolonne, der viser måneden som et tal fra 1 til 12, f.eks. 4 for april, der er afledt af en DOB Dato/klokkeslæt-kolonnedatatype. |
Se også
Hjælp til Power Query til Excel
Tilføje en brugerdefineret kolonne (docs.com)